Tears of the past!

One Piece Manga chapter 717 review


Rating: 4/5 

This chapter gave a lot more than the last one as we see some character development and a few hints about bits and things that were in my mind. 

So, the chapter starts off Luffy and Don Qinjao fighting in Block C. I think this is very subtle but Oda has given us a hint of what One Piece is by saying what it means to be the King of Pirates. We see Don Qinjao saying what as he said "... there are countless people with the right qualities to become a King. You must challenge them!! You must be the top of all the conquerors. That's who the King of Pirates is!!" Even if it is very arguable, it is still a hint. This tells us that Luffy is going to fight every Yonkou, Schichibukai, Marines and pirates as this is what it takes to be the King of the Pirates. We already know 3 of the 4 Yonkou that Luffy has a problem or wants to fight with and they are Shanks, Blackbeard and Big Mam and now Law has targeted Kaido so that's all the Yonkou. We already know a few Schichibukai that he has fought with and he is going to fight one now. 

Then we see Don Qinjao crying because of the past. I think he was very close to getting One Piece since he also has a problem with Rayleigh and that means he had a problem with Roger too. However, he didn't get One Piece as Garp stopped him. Or Roger himself stopped him and Garp took him in. Don Qinjao doesn't seem to know what Garp did to him but he just knows its Garp which I think is very stupid as it could be anyone. It might even be that they helped him but he looked at that help in the wrong light and if that is true then i think he needs to sort himself out. I think that when he headbutted a continent he was close to Raftel but he couldn't go any further as he was severely injured and Garp probably helped him heal but took him away from Raftel and Don only remember being taken away from Raftel so he took it in the wrong light. 

Then we see Sanji and Kinemon. They are near the Colosseum and they see the Marines surrounding it. Which is quite clever as they can arrest or attack any of the wanted criminals or pirates. We see a Vice Admiral outside waiting as well and he mentions Maynard and how he is waiting for Maynard to contact him but we know that Bartolomeo killed Maynard and I can see him coming out and saying it like he doesn't care. I think it's a bit weird how some of the losers from Block A and B aren't out yet as they should be since they have nothing to do now. Maybe they're in the factory already. 

Now, we see the toy with Franky talking and this is very weird, although most of the readers guessed it. The toys were actually human before but they were turned into a toy by a Devil Fruit eater, most likely it was Jola. But why would Doflamingo do that? I mean he has basically ruined so many families and relationships but why? Maybe to test his artificial Devil Fruits? The weird thing is that once you're turned into a toy the memories of you are vanished from the people that knew you. Also, the toy with Franky mentions that there are two rules that have been obeyed since Doflamingo became the King 10 years ago: 1) Toys and humans can not enter each others house and 2) Lights in town go off at 12:00 am. After that no one is allowed out. It is weird how this law was made. There must be a reason and I think that the reason is that after 12 the factory starts working and they don't want anyone getting any hints about it. And the first rule is even more weird. Humans are not allowed in toys's houses and vice versa but for what reason? To stop them reproducing maybe? Or to stop the toys generating feelings in the humans heart and to stop awakening their old memories? 

We see Doflamingo and Law and Fujitora fighting which is good, to be honest. Law is still holding up which is good to see. He is trying to contact Nami for some reason. 

We also see Robin and Usopp with the Dwarves and we find out that the factory is actually under the Colosseum which is quite a good place to put it since no one would suspect anything there and also that would explain why no one has seen the factory.

Finally I give this chapter 4/5 because we got to see a lot and we have been given a lot of information regarding the final decisive battle. Overall I enjoyed it a lot.
